-
oracle组函数avg(),sum(),max(),min(),count()、多行函数,分组数据(group by,求各部门的平均工资),分组过滤(having和where),sql优化详解
1组函数 avg(),sum(),max(),min(),count()示例: selectavg(sal),sum(sal),max(sal),min(sal),count(sal) from emp/ 截图: 2 组函数和null在一起 案例:求员工的平均奖金 错误sql: select avg(comm) 方式1,sum(comm)/count(comm)方式2,sum(comm)/count(*) 方式3 from emp; 截图: 错误原因: select count(comm),count(*) from emp; 分析: --组函数自动滤空,组函数忽略空值 --修正函数的滤空 select count(nvl(comm,0)),count(*) fromemp; 3.分组数据 A 求各个部门的平均工资 思路:需要把各个部门的数据划分…....
PHP 2014-11-29 05:04:59 -
PHP下安装Oracle客户端扩展(OCI8)的方法
本文主要为大家讲解了如何在PHP下安装Oracle客户端扩展(OCI8)的方法,本文在Linux系统中实现,OCI8是用来连接Oracle数据库的PHP扩展模块,感兴趣的同学参考下. 最近的项目需要用php访问oracle数据库,不得不在linux下给php安装oci8扩展。php也可以使用pdo访问oracle数据库,但还是需要安装客户端...
PHP 2014-11-29 04:44:18 -
Oracle的版本
以8.1.7.4.0为例说明: 8:版本号 1:新特性版本号 7:维护版本号 4:普通的补丁设置号码 0:特殊的平台补丁设置号码 另外有关Oracle是32bit/64bit的问题,说明如下: 在windows/linux系统中由于操作系统是32bit的,所以oracle肯定是32bit的; 在tru64中oracle肯定是64bit的; 在hpux/aix/solaris中要看具体情况了,如果是64bit的在server上启动sqlplus时会显示64bit的字样,你也可以通过 select * from v$version;或$ file $ORACLE_HOME/bin/oracle|more来查看,如: <hpux>$ file $ORACLE_HOME/bin/oracle|more /data1/app/oracle/product/8.1.7/bin/oracle: ELF-64 executable object file - PA-RISC 2.0 (LP64) 如果希望支持大于1.75GB的SGA,那么建议使用64Bi...
PHP 2014-11-29 04:43:15 -
oracle单行函数,多行函数,字符函数,数字函数,日期函数,数据类型转换,数字和字符串转换,通用函数(case和decode)使用方法
本文为大家讲解的是oracle数据库中的函数使用方法包括:单行函数,多行函数,字符函数,数字函数,日期函数,数据类型转换,数字和字符串转换,通用函数(case和decode)使用方法,感兴趣的同学参考下. 1 多行函数(理解:有多个输入,但只输出1个结果) SQL>select count(*) from emp; COUNT(*) ------------- 14 B 字符函数Lower &...
PHP 2014-11-29 04:42:00 -
CentOS 5 上安装Oracle10g
1. 域名解析设置及网络配置 # vi /etc/hosts 127.0.0.1 localhost.localdomain localhost ::1 localhost6.localdomain6 localhost6 192.168.56.103 hyl # vi /etc/sysconfig/network-scripts/ifcfg-eth0 --修改网卡配置 &nb...
PHP 2014-11-29 04:39:16 -
Oracle 常见问题解答
本文为大家搜集罗列一些常见的oracle问题,感兴趣的同学参考下. 关于 SELECT N 问题 有感于一些网友多次咨询和讨论选取某些指定行数据的问题, 我写了下面这样的简单说明, 请大家指正. 这里描述的 SELECT N 包括这样几种情况: 1. 选取TOP N行记录 2. 选取N1-N2行记录 3. 选取FOOT N行记录 当然需要考虑是否有ORDER BY子句的情况, 下面试以系统视图CAT为例分别说明. 注: A. 为没有ORDER BY的情况 B. 有ORDER BY的情况 1. 选取 TOP N 行记录 A. SELECT * FROM CAT WHERE ROWNUM<=N B. SELECT * FROM ( SELECT * FROM CAT ORDER BY TABLE_TYPE ) WHERE ROWNUM<=N 2. 选取N1-N2行记录 A. SELECT TABLE_NAME,TABLE_TYPE FROM ( SELECT ROWNUM ROWSEQ,TABLE_NAME,TABLE_TY...
PHP 2014-11-29 04:28:13 -
PHP访问ORACLE LOB方法
PHP,即“PHP: Hypertext Preprocessor”,是一种广泛用于 Open Source(开放源代码)并可以嵌入 HTML 的多用途脚本语言。它的语法接近 C、Java 和 Perl,易于学习...
PHP 2014-11-29 04:23:21 -
Oracle TAF的配置
Oracle TAF的配置 TAF为Transparent Application FailOver的缩写,一般应用TAF都是在OPS/RAC环境中。从8i开始有的这一功能,目的和想法都是很好的,但目前应用还很有限,本文将针对TAF相关问题作个详细探讨...
PHP 2014-11-29 04:20:43 -
雅虎联袂Flickr 助推图像识别技术
11月28日消息,不久之前,人们认为图像识别将会是另一个引领未来之浪潮,如今这样的想法已经不常见了。但是现在,由于拍摄及存储的照片之规模愈发庞大,而且又需要即快且易地找到它们,摄影技术便把图像识别技术推到了发展之前沿,舞台的中心...
云资讯 2014-11-28 21:01:21 -
雅虎Flickr开发出图片搜索新算法
图像识别已被认为是未来的技术潮流。而随着技术的不断进步,图像识别也不再是一项独立的技术,它开始跟其他的技术结合,以此提高搜索算法和结果的质量...
信息安全 2014-11-28 16:53:32 -
JQUERY获取form表单text,areatext,radio,checkbox,select值
本文为大家整理的是jquery取得text,areatext,radio,checkbox,select的值,以及其他一些操作,感兴趣的同学参考下. 1...
PHP 2014-11-28 10:52:41 -
使用DiskPart工具配置U盘来安装wind7系统
在电脑上安装windows7系统,除了下载正式版本的windows7系统,还可以用移动硬盘安装,但是如果网友们觉得这两种办法还是不太方便,那么现在还有一种方法供网友们使用,用USB闪盘驱动安装Win 7的技巧,我们一起来看看吧! 在这篇文章里我们将向大家展示如何使用DiskPart工具来配置可启动式USB闪盘驱动,以便大家使用USB闪盘驱动安装微软Windows 7操作系统。 当然,首先我们要准备一个内存空间足够装下Windows 7DVD的USB闪盘驱动...
系统程序 2014-11-28 09:37:07